(Senior) Full Stack Developer - Python (all genders)
Locations: Tbilisi (Georgia)
What awaits you
- Design and develop scalable backend systems using Python and FastAPI.
- Create and manage RESTful APIs, ensuring seamless integration across services.
- Collaborate with frontend development using TypeScript and React, supported by testing frameworks like Vitest or Jest.
- Manage containerized applications using Kubernetes and Docker.
- Contribute your experience in implementing and managing customer-oriented projects.
What we expect from you
- Personal background: You have a qualification as a Full Stack or Python Developer.
- Technical Expertise: You have experience with FastAPI, REST, and API design. You are also skilled in TypeScript, React, and unit testing frameworks such as Vitest/Jest.
- You are familiar with cloud services (AWS/Azure) and have a good understanding of DevOps practices and tools.
- Hands-on experience with Kubernetes and Docker for container orchestration.
- Mindset: You are solution- and service-oriented, reliable, responsible for actions and enjoy teamwork.
- Let's talk: If you speak fluent English (and possibly German), you'll fit right in at Exxeta.
Nice to Have:
- Familiarity with tools like FastMCP, Alembic, PostgreSQL, and OpenAPI for database and API management.
- Experience with Helm, Grafana, and GitHub Actions for monitoring and continuous integration.
- Understanding of authentication standards such as OIDC, OAuth2.0, and usage of AWS services.
Why Exxeta
- Take on challenging tasks in in-house development
- Develop your skills further through continuous training, conference participation and internal knowledge exchange
- Enjoy a professional environment within a relaxed, friendly corporate culture
- Stay healthy - our company supports you with a corporate health insurance
We are a home for tech lovers and doers. Origin, age, preferences—none of that matters to us.
Think you don't meet all the requirements 100%? That shouldn't stop you, because we're looking for people, not checkboxes. Even if you can't tick every box, we'd still love to receive your application. Diversity and different perspectives enrich our team – because diversity makes us better.
We want to get to know you and find out what you have to offer. Still have questions? Then get in touch.
- Yelena Denissenko
- Senior Talent Acquisition Partner
- +49 172 9912694
- yelena.denissenko@exxeta.com
